Addressing Vermont's Affordable Housing Crisis
Vermont faces one of the nation's most severe housing affordability challenges, with Vermont Housing Finance Agency reporting a shortage of over 24,000 affordable rental units statewide. South Burlington, as the state's second-largest city and home to major employers like the University of Vermont Medical Center, experiences particularly acute pressure. The co-living Vermont model through PadSplit directly addresses this crisis by maximizing existing housing stock efficiency.
Traditional rental units in South Burlington often price out essential workers, young professionals, and graduate students who form the backbone of the local economy. By implementing a rent by room South Burlington strategy, investors can offer affordable housing solutions while generating significantly higher revenue per square foot than conventional leasing methods.

Superior Cash Flow Potential
The financial advantages of South Burlington real estate investing through PadSplit are compelling. Where a traditional three-bedroom home might rent for $2,200-$2,800 monthly, the same property converted to PadSplit can generate $3,500-$4,500 through individual room rentals. This 40-60% revenue increase transforms marginal deals into high cash flow rentals VT that provide substantial monthly cash flow even after accounting for increased management and utilities costs.

Due Diligence and Property Analysis
Before committing to a PadSplit South Burlington investment, conduct thorough market analysis. Research comparable rental rates through platforms like Apartments.com and local rental listings to understand per-room pricing in your target area.
Evaluate the property's potential for room optimization. Can you convert common areas or add legal bedrooms? Consider renovation costs against potential rental increases. Properties requiring significant updates should be priced accordingly to maintain your target cash flow metrics.
Review local zoning laws and rental regulations carefully. South Burlington has specific occupancy requirements that may affect your ability to maximize room count. Consult with local housing authorities to ensure compliance with all regulations governing rent by room South Burlington operations.

Navigating the Challenges: What Every Investor Must Know
However, South Burlington real estate investing through PadSplit models isn't without challenges. Zoning regulations in South Burlington can be restrictive, with many single-family residential zones limiting the number of unrelated occupants. Before purchasing, verify that your target property allows for your intended use through the South Burlington Planning and Zoning Department.
Property management intensity increases significantly with room-by-room rentals. You'll handle multiple tenant relationships, coordinate shared space usage, and manage higher turnover rates typical in co-living Vermont arrangements. Additionally, insurance costs may increase, and some lenders have restrictions on properties intended for room rental use.
